Hi night team,

Please note that the door sensors on the east corridor at Halloway Court have been recalled by the supplier, Verdant Entry Systems, due to intermittent false readings. Until replacements arrive next week, those doors will not auto-release. Check each one manually on your rounds and record the time in the log. To override a stuck door, use the code below.

badge for fafop-fajof: bdg-Z-47

## Quillpress Environments

Quillpress renders PDF invoices for the Larkfield billing stack. Three environments: dev, staging, prod. Dev uses the stub font cache; staging and prod pull from the shared glyph store. Prod runs four replicas behind the Tollgate proxy; staging runs one. Rendering timeouts differ per environment — do not copy prod values into staging. Template bundles are promoted via the Ferrow pipeline only. Review diffs against the values below before approving. Current prod configuration follows.

service settings:
[casax]
port = 6379
team = rusir
host = casax.zemvarhq.corp
region = outer-4
access_code = ac_9808ce
timeout_ms = 1500

For the Veriflux plugin loader: I kept validator discovery lazy so cold start stays fast, but that means a bad plugin only fails at first use. Release-wise, please make sure the registry scan runs in the smoke suite before tagging. Timeouts and retry caps are now centralized instead of scattered — current values shown below.

tuning constants:
QUOTAS = {
    "druwyn": 5,
    "holix": 5,
    "zorath": 5,
    "holwyn": 10,
}

Meeting notes, Halverton receiving site. Discussed replacement lock for the basement safe, sourced from Quillmark Security. The unit ships Thursday with Brenna Oldfield coordinating. Receiving must log serials on arrival, keep the lock sealed in its factory wrap, and store it in the cage until the fitter from Dunmore Locksmithing arrives. The courier will require verification at the dock; the confirmation line follows.

handover note for tadug-yaguf: the aldath pelwyn courier leaves the casox norwyn briix silok zorok kasdor aldion quenox ledger at gate 2653 under passcode 959015